A Bit About Us

We are all about owning what we do. We’re a 100% employee-owned multi-faceted contractor who thrives on delivering complex heavy civil projects by developing innovative infrastructure solutions. Since our founding in 1972, we have grown into a team of more than 2,700 employee-owners that are experts in excavation, grading, underground utilities, bridge construction, and asphalt and concrete paving.

Job Details

Join our team as a Heavy Civil, Sr. PM - Alternative Delivery, and play a vital role within our team. This position offers a challenging and rewarding opportunity to lead high-profile, complex heavy civil construction projects. We are seeking a highly motivated, detail-oriented professional with a strong background in progressive design-build and/or CMGC, self-perform, heavy civil/heavy highway construction. The ideal candidate will have a minimum of 7 years of experience in these areas.

Responsibilities

You will be responsible for managing all aspects of heavy civil construction projects from inception to completion. This includes:

  • Overseeing the progressive design build process, ensuring that all designs are completed on time and within budget.
  • Coordinating and supervising self-perform construction activities, ensuring that all work is completed in accordance with project specifications and safety standards.
  • Managing heavy civil and heavy highway construction projects, ensuring that all work is completed on schedule and within budget.
  • Liaising with DOT and other regulatory bodies, ensuring that all work is compliant with applicable laws and regulations.
  • Overseeing project management activities, including planning, scheduling, and coordinating work activities, and monitoring project progress.
  • Conducting forecasting, budgeting, and estimating activities, ensuring that all financial aspects of the project are managed effectively.
  • Communicating effectively with all project stakeholders, including clients, contractors, and team members, ensuring that all parties are kept informed of project progress and any issues that arise.
Qualifications

To be considered for the Permanent Heavy Civil Sr. PM - Alternative Delivery position, candidates must possess the following qualifications:

  • A minimum of 7 years of experience in progressive design build, self-perform, heavy civil construction.
  • Proven ability to manage complex heavy civil construction projects, with a track record of delivering projects on time and within budget.
  • Strong knowledge of DOT regulations and other applicable laws and regulations.
  • Excellent project management skills, with the ability to plan, schedule, and coordinate work activities, and monitor project progress.
  • Strong financial management skills, with the ability to conduct forecasting, budgeting, and estimating activities.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to effectively communicate with all project stakeholders.
  • A strong commitment to safety, with the ability to ensure that all work is completed in accordance with safety standards.
